Columbia Science Olympiad students wearing medals at Pocono InvitationalColumbia Science Olympiad placed 5th at the North Pocono Invitational on Saturday, winning 17 medals. The tournament included 20 high school teams from the Northeast and was held in person at North Pocono High School in Covington Township, Pennsylvania.
